Output 3fef0b8c3c4a4d74c80be3360cc382a589093544b1ff640b71be673df7515e64:1

value
149660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cc1301ca0452c072396a22e99db14fac7194242 OP_EQUAL
address
3Ju4PYLKJzi6PURbyKdmV1kes46yGVzgdY
transaction
3fef0b8c3c4a4d74c80be3360cc382a589093544b1ff640b71be673df7515e64
spent
true